About MDS

Company Overview
MDS is the UK’s foremost provider of management training for the food industry. Founded in 1986 as a not-for-profit membership organisation, we create a pipeline of well trained, capable leaders to work in all aspects of the food supply chain. Each MDS trainee completes an industry specific qualification alongside a series of challenging secondments with member companies. Our programmes last for 18 months to two years and at the end of each programme members have the opportunity to recruit trainees. In the last 35 years, every MDS alumnus has succeeded in gaining employment within the industry.

Company Culture at MDS

The employee experience below at MDS, compared to a typical company.

84% of employees at MDS say it is a great place to work*, compared to 54% of employees at a typical UK based company.
MDS
84%
Typical Company
54%
*Responses to the statement “Taking everything into account, I would say this is a great place to work.” vs. a typical UK company.
